I'm looking for a small radar for my replica 22m dutch barge. It will
be mainly used on inland waterways in Europe and coastal waters -
Baltic, Agean, Med etc plus Channel crossings. Narrowed choice of
small radars down to the above listed - would appreciate comments and
experience.

TVMIA



The best buy at the Vancouver Boat Show was the JRC 1500 mk2 - only
Can$1199 from most dealers, and good recommendations (from the
dealers). Apparently the Mk 2 has a better display than the original
1500. The JRC 1000 was only $50 cheaper at West Marine, and the
Furuno 1623 was more expensive, and had a slightly wider antenna
beamwidth (therefore, poorer target discrimination).

I bought one today, but (obviously) have no experience with it yet.
